A versatile lawyer, Marc-Alexandre Hudon is a member of both the Litigation and the Corporate and Commercial Law groups. His practice focuses primarily on the protection of personal information, cybersecurity, public contracts, business integrity, administrative law and Aboriginal law. He acts for a wide range of clients, particularly in the natural resources and energy, infrastructure, health and technology sectors. A seasoned litigator before both Québec courts and the Federal Court, he assists clients with investigations, transactions and various related matters.
 
Protection of Personal Information and Cybersecurity: Marc-Alexandre has a deep understanding of the legal issues involved in the protection of personal information and cybersecurity, at both the provincial and federal levels. His expertise in this area includes investigations, providing advice and representing clients before the Commission d’accès à l’information du Québec and the Federal Court. Marc-Alexandre also advises clients on all aspects of personal information protection pertaining to artificial intelligence (AI).
 
Internal Investigations, Public Contracts and Business Integrity: Marc-Alexandre has extensive expertise in internal investigations, public contracts and, more broadly, business integrity, as well as anti-corruption legislation at both the national and international levels.
 
Aboriginal Law: Marc-Alexandre advises Canadian and international clients on all aspects of Canadian Aboriginal law, including in connection with business transactions, litigation, or matters relating to Aboriginal consultation and accommodation processes, treaties and the Indian Act. He is also recognized for his significant experience in creating and implementing joint ventures, co-enterprises and other partnerships that qualify as Aboriginal businesses with First Nations in Ontario, Québec, Nunavut, Saskatchewan, Manitoba, and Newfoundland and Labrador.
 
Administrative Law and Professional Law: In the area of commercial litigation, Marc-Alexandre regularly represents clients in matters such as judicial reviews, administrative law remedies, and complex legal proceedings related to his other areas of practice.
